What is recorded here

Detached four-bay single-storey lobby entry thatched farmhouse with half-dormer attic, extant 1840, on a rectangular plan off-centred on single-bay single-storey flat-roofed windbreak. Occupied, 1990. Vacated, 2001. Now disused. Remains of chicken wire-covered hipped oat thatch roof on collared split bough construction, exposed hazel stretchers to degraded ridge having exposed scallops, and blind stretchers to eaves having blind scallops. Limewashed rendered battered. Square-headed off-central door opening with concrete threshold, and concealed dressings framing glazed timber panelled door. Square-headed window openings with concrete sills, and concealed dressings framing two-over-two (ground floor) or three-over-six (half-dormer attic) timber sash windows having part exposed sash boxes with two-over-two timber sash windows to gables to side elevations; two-over-two timber sash windows to rear (north) elevation having part exposed sash boxes. Set in courtyard with limewashed rendered piers to perimeter having pyramidal capping supporting replacement tubular mild steel "farm gate".
